The instrumental for "Give Me Everything"—originally by Pitbull featuring Ne-Yo , Afrojack , and Nayer—is a definitive example of early 2010s EDM-pop production. Produced primarily by Afrojack with arrangement by DJ Buddha, the track served as a high-energy "floor-filler" that helped define the era's club sound.
